Output ef5308f993b72b8cdeea5da4e0e50d8d431bc39967bbb002a9822db5f1aedce6:1

value
64492439
script pubkey
OP_0 OP_PUSHBYTES_20 887c20b10f1c4b6afcb7475cbb7af1a045d9f585
address
bc1q3p7zpvg0r39k4l9hgawtk7h35pzanav9h7a57n
transaction
ef5308f993b72b8cdeea5da4e0e50d8d431bc39967bbb002a9822db5f1aedce6
spent
true